
The two must-see sights are St. Peter's Basilica and the Sistine Chapel, located in Vatican City. St. Peter’s Basilica, begun by Pope Julius II in 1506 and completed a hundred years later in 1615 under Paul V. It is designed as a three-aisled Latin cross with a Dome at the crossing, directly above the high alter, which covers the shrine of St. Peter the Apostle.
